Fiji Airways launches Inaugural flight from Suva to Sydney

Published on : Monday, May 5, 2014

Fiji Airways plane.Fiji Airways took its inaugural direct service from Sydney to Suva this afternoon. This direct service from Australia to the Fijian capital offers Australians even greater connectivity to Fiji.
 

 
Fiji Airways will offer twice-weekly direct flights between Sydney to Suva, operated by its B737-700 aircraft. The direct services will operate on Mondays and Fridays, with a morning departure from Suva (10.15am FJT) and an afternoon departure from Sydney (2.20pm AEST).

 

 
This new flight route will provide greater connectivity to Suva, Fiji’s capital and Pacific Harbour, the adventure capital of Fiji as well as the beautiful tropical outer islands of Beqa and Vatulele. The new route will also allow much more ease and convenience for those travelling for business, visiting family or holidaying in Fiji in this region.

 

 
Stefan Pichler, Fiji Airways Managing Director and CEO comments: “We’re excited about the introduction of this new service, which will allow Australian travellers to further explore and experience all that Fiji has to offer. The introduction of the direct Sydney to Suva flight will not only open up tourism for Suva, Pacific Harbour and surrounding islands, but also provide more convenient travel options for Government and business travelers. The new service is a clear demonstration of our desire to grow our network, and boost Fijian tourism and economy.”
